**Highways Technology Technician**

**Are you looking for your next challenge?** As a **Highways Technology Technician **you’ll be working as a key member of the Telent Technology Maintenance Team in the MRTC area eastern region. If you don’t already have you will gain an understanding of the technology equipment in the MRTC area including AMIs, Message Signs, CCTV, MIDAS, ERTs, Cabinets, Traffic Signals, Weather stations, traffic counting technologies and Ramp Metering.

**What you’ll do**:
Responsible for completing all technology maintenance tasks as determined by Service Delivery Manager. Undertake reactive and planned maintenance on equipment in MRTC Area for the Eastern region.
- Gain knowledge of current technologies, standards, specifications, standards and best practice relating to National Highways Motorway and trunk road communications systems.
- Will comply with legislation and have correct risk assessments and method statements
- Complete essential maintenance tasks on motorway communications equipment, as laid down by agreed maintenance schedules
- Will attend to emergency faults and knock downs and carry out corrective maintenance including the reinstatement of sites, cable and equipment damaged by others.
- Attend to faults outside normal working hours on a rota basis.
Raise site EQH&S issues within the team and identify opportunities for improvement and innovation

**Desirable requirements**:

- Experience of working in electronics/communications industry
- Fibre or Copper fault finding experience
- PC literate/IT proficient
- Electrical fault-finding background, ideally 18th edition but not mandatory
- G39 awareness of working near live power
